Brace yourselves: Windows 11 may have more popups

Posted on September 15, 2021August 27, 2023 By Jarvis

A new, updated Tips app with more content is headed to Windows 11, too. But will “ads” pushing Windows 11 eventually appear?

Popups within Windows are one of the operating system’s more polarizing features. If you’re not a fan, you may want to brace yourself, because Microsoft is testing whether or not to add even more to Windows 11. It might not be bad news, though.
